Lemon Blueberry Muffins: Quick and Easy Gourmet Treats at Home

- 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
- 1 cup fresh blueberries
- ½ cup granulated sugar
- ½ cup unsalted butter, melted
- 2 large eggs
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 2 tablespoons lemon juice
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- ½ teaspoon baking soda
- ¼ teaspoon salt
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with paper liners.
- In a large bowl, combine the fl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.
- In another bowl, whisk together the melted butter, eggs, vanilla extract, lemon juice, and zest.
- Mix the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ients until just combined.
- Gently fold in the blueberries.
- Divide the batter evenly among the muffin cups.
- Bake for 20-25 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
- Allow to cool before serving.
Notes
- For extra lemon flavor, consider adding lemon zest to the batter.
- These muffins can be frozen for later enjoyment.
